A kind of transformer substation grounding wire Real-time Monitor Management method
Technical field
The present invention relates to the management method of earth lead in a kind of transformer station, belong to power system technical field of security and protection.
Background technology
Transformer substation grounding wire is electric wiring or the equipment interruption maintenance required a kind of safety appliance of work, is to ensure that the life line of operations staff's personal safety.According to the applicant understood; current most of electric power enterprise except in system earth wire make to be used as some basic demands in addition to; earth wire specifically used and manage specification not enough; there are problems; traditional artificial report mode is easily caused temporary ground wire misconnection, tears open by mistake, misses, leaks and the electric power accident such as tear open and occur so that the earth lead that should play a protective role has become great maloperation hidden danger on the contrary.Once having an accident, consequence is serious.Thereby it is ensured that the correctness of dismounting earth lead is an important process in substation safety anti-error system.

At present, increasing transformer station the most no longer possesses independent " five prevent " system, the substitute is the embedded anti-error system being integrated within converting equipment.The transformer substation grounding wire Real-time Monitor Management method that the present invention provides, based on independent " five prevent " system, by means such as intelligent entrance guard, Internet of Things, network technology, computer management software, embedded data acquisitions to transformer substation grounding wire registration, state in place, authorize, use position, the overall process such as give back and carry out implementing monitoring and management.Staff swipes the card at substation field and opens gate inhibition's entrance, then opens safety tool cupboard door, takes and be allowed for earth lead;If having taken the earth lead being not allowed to, the most all produce alarm signal prompting;Management software is each group earth lead information in place in taking rear cabinet by graphical interfaces real-time update;Staff by ground wire hitching on corresponding earth point;Transformer substation grounding wire real-time monitoring and managing system software graphical interface real-time update each earth point mounting earth lead information in place;After earth lead uses, Field Force removes earth lead (transformer substation grounding wire real-time monitoring and managing system graphical interfaces more fresh information), swipe the card and open safety tool cupboard, earth lead is placed on original position (transformer substation grounding wire real-time monitoring and managing system graphical interfaces more fresh information), if earth lead is not placed into original position, can trigger and locally, remotely produce alarm signal prompting.Thus, complete whole earth lead mandate, get, mount, remove, give back overall process, the in real time monitoring omnidistance to whole process of transformer substation grounding wire real-time monitoring and managing system, there is abnormal conditions the most locally, remotely alarm.

Detailed description of the invention
Embodiment
The transformer substation grounding wire Real-time Monitor Management method that the present embodiment provides, as shown in Figure 1, wherein, transformer station has gate control system 5, gate control system 5 includes card reader 11, allot to the card of operator, access controller 10 and electric control lock 12, during work, the Card Reader signal output part of card reader 11 connects the Card Reader signal input part of access controller 10, the controlled end of the control signal output termination electric control lock 12 of access controller 10, thus control the keying of its tapered end, connect the door condition sensor of access controller 10 state signal input terminal equipped with signal output part on this external door 13.Access controller 10 purchases the controller that model is NSV-818 from NARI company, electric control lock 12 purchases the electric control lock that model is NSV-818-260L from NARI company, with door condition sensor on it, card reader 11 purchases the card reader that model is NSV-818-Q from NARI company, is configured with card simultaneously.
Being equipped with unique RFID label tag 8 on each earth lead, being provided with multiple rfid interrogator 7 in transformer station to cover safety tool cupboard and the earth lead mount point depositing earth lead;Gate control system 5 is connected to server 1 by communication network 4;Rfid interrogator 7 is connected with earth lead manager 6, and earth lead manager 6 is connected to server 1 also by communication network 4;The outfan of earth lead manager 6 is also equipped with local alarm instruction device 9.
Connect wires manager 6 circuit as shown in Figure 3, it is major function chip by STC89C52, the information that card reader 11 sends over is received by pin P1.0 to P1.7, then it is sent to, through RJ45 interface circuit as shown in Figure 4, be sent to server 1 by communication network via RJ45 interface by RXD Yu TXD.
P0.0 to the P0.7 pin of STC89C52 and P2.0 to P2.7 pin then in order to drive the liquid crystal display of local alarm instruction device 9, carry out the contents such as display alarm information.If it is desired, buzzer etc. also can be driven to send sound alarm.
The flow chart of the present embodiment is as in figure 2 it is shown, specifically include following steps:
In a, server, typing in advance has the information (i.e. holding operator's information such as name, the identity information etc. of card) of card and authority information corresponding to card image (i.e. hold the operating right of the operator of card for example whether have the right to open the door, attachment/detachment earth lead etc. of whether having the right), earth lead information (such as earth lead attachment/detachment position, earth lead labelling etc.) and with the FRID label information on corresponding earth lead, by label and earth lead one_to_one corresponding;
B, when operator use its card to read in card reader, the card image read is delivered to server and is contrasted by gate control system;
C, server contrast with the typing information in advance in data base after receiving this card image, if this card image meets and has enabling authority, then instruction gate control system output enabling signal performs enabling to electric control lock, record operator's information and door opening and closing state information, show at graphical interfaces after server update record simultaneously;As do not met, send warning information;
After d, operator enter transformer station, when taking earth lead away from the safety tool cupboard placing earth lead, earth lead can be made to depart from the coverage of former rfid interrogator, after arriving infield, enter the coverage of new rfid interrogator, thus trigger this rfid interrogator and the status information (i.e. whether earth lead is installed in correct position) of earth lead that is removed and that install is uploaded onto the server, server update record, and show at graphical interfaces;
When earth lead is removed from installation site and is given back to safety tool cupboard, same, this operation can make earth lead depart from the coverage of former rfid interrogator, enter the coverage of the new rfid interrogator in safety tool cupboard position, thus trigger this rfid interrogator and the status information (the most whether removed correct earth lead and given back) of the earth lead being returned is uploaded onto the server, server update record, and show at graphical interfaces;
E, server contrast with the typing information in advance in data base according to the authority information of the operator's card read, judge whether it has the authority of attachment/detachment earth lead, if met, the most only carry out record, database update and graphical interfaces update, if do not met, then send warning information;If met, by this operation note;
F, server contrast with the typing information in advance in data base according to the earth lead RFID information changed, (attachment/detachment position is the most correct to judge whether meet operating specification by the earth lead taken away, whether earth lead is marked as damaging), if do not met, send warning information;Or judge that the earth lead given back is the most correct, as incorrect, then send warning information.
Warning information is different according to warning content, according to content set in advance, the graphical interfaces of alarm indicator shows, is sent to phone number set in advance by the alarm message of pre-set content simultaneously, to point out operation not meet specification.
